Hayden agrees to 1-year deal with Bears
The Chicago Bears agreed to a one-year contract with veteran cornerback Kelvin Hayden on Tuesday.
Hayden made two starts and played in 16 games last season for Chicago and led the league with four opponent fumble recoveries. He also recorded 40 tackles and an interception to go with three special-teams stops.

Report: Bears Expected To Sign CB Kelvin Hayden
According to Vaughn McClure, the Chicago Bears are expected to re-sign free agent CB Kelvin Hayden.
Hayden, 29, has found almost no interest up to this point, but the Bears did lose free agent D.J. Moore to the Panthers last week. They could use help at slot corner and Hayden, but he was relegated to playing 472 snaps last season and appeared to be a bit of liability in coverage...

Grimes, Hayden inactive for Falcons in Houston
Cornerbacks Brent Grimes and Kelvin Hayden are among the inactive players for Atlanta in Sunday's game against Houston.
Grimes, an alternate Pro Bowl pick in 2010, had minor surgery on his right knee Thursday and will be sidelined from two to four weeks. Hayden, a nickel back, is missing his second straight game with a toe injury.
